UK Household Energy Bills to Increase by £332 Annually from July, Forecasts Reveal

Cornwall Insight projects that UK household energy bills will rise by an average of £332 per year starting in July due to elevated summer energy prices. This increase reflects worsening energy cost dynamics influenced by Middle East conflicts, intensifying financial pressure on consumers.
